在Postman中输入服务器地址http://localhost:5000/并发送请求,应该能够正确返回JSON数据。 总结 通过本文的介绍,我们学习了如何在Python中使用HTTP返回JSON数据。使用Flask框架可以快速实现一个简单的HTTP服务器,并使用jsonify函数将字典数据转换为JSON格式。JSON作为一种轻量级的数据交换格式,在Web开发中应用广泛,掌握如何返...
importjson# 处理GET请求defdo_GET(self):# 获取请求路径path=self.path# 检查是否为请求JSON数据的路径ifpath=="/api/data":# 假设我们从数据库中获取了一些数据data={"name":"John","age":30,"city":"New York"}# 将数据转换为JSON格式json_data=json.dumps(data)# 发送响应self.send_response(200)s...
可以看到json_encode中 json dumps方法并没有给定ensure_ascii的值,所以ensure_ascii就是默认值True,也就是,被序列化的数据中的字符串所有非ascii的字符都会转义为unicode形式。 解决办法,就是手动处理json数据,将ensure_ascii设定为False。 json.dumps(value, ensure_ascii=False) 老项目没办法,新项目必定是python3...
首先,我们需要使用Python的`requests`库来发送HTTP请求并获取JSON数据。下面是一个简单的示例代码: ```python import requests url = 'https://api.example.com/data' response = requests.get(url) data = response.json() ``` 在这个示例中,我们使用`requests.get()`方法发送了一个GET请求,并通过`response....
python 读取 http请求状态码 json 文件 一、完整键值对 以下状态码保存到文件 http_response_status_code_full.json 点击展开代码 [ { "_comment1": "Http 返回信息的状态码,json 格式,用于服务封装", "_comment2": "https://www.cnblogs.com/wutou/p/17738708.html" },{ "code":100, "message":"...
response = requests.get('https://api.example.com/data') 在解析JSON数据之前,你应该检查HTTP响应的状态码以确保请求成功。 python复制代码 if response.status_code == 200: # 请求成功,继续解析JSON数据 else: # 请求失败,处理错误或重试 如果响应状态码表示成功(通常是200),你可以使用response.json()方法来...
首先,我们需要使用Python的`requests`库来发送HTTP请求并获取JSON数据。下面是一个简单的示例代码: ```python import requests url = 'https://api.example.com/data' response = requests.get(url) data = response.json() ``` 在这个示例中,我们使用`requests.get()`方法发送了一个GET请求,并通过`response...
在Python中使用JSON响应HTTP请求是一种常见的技术,用于在客户端和服务器之间传递数据。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,具有易读易写的特性,常用于Web应用程序的数据传输和存储。 在Python中,可以使用内置的json模块来处理JSON数据。下面是一个完整的例子,展示了如何使用Python中的JSON模块来...
在Web开发中,经常需要发送JSON格式的HTTP请求来与服务器进行交互。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,它基于ECMAScript的一个子集,采用完全独立于语言的文本格式来存储和表示数据。Python提供了多种库来发送HTTP请求,其中最常用的是requests库,因为它提供了简单且强大的API来发送各种类型的HTTP请...
fromdjango.core.urlresolversimportreversedefindex(request):returnHttpResponseRedirect(reverse('booktest:index2',args=(1,))) 子类JsonResponse 返回json数据,一般用于异步请求 _init _(data) 帮助用户创建JSON编码的响应 参数data是字典对象 JsonResponse的默认Content-Type为application/json ...